Merlins is a family restaurant with breakfast all day plus lots of other options. I was seated within minutes. Knowing I would have to be quick, I ordered the Bennie Skillet, which is a layer of hash browns topped with English muffin, your choice of ham, bacon, or sausage, plus 2 eggs over easy, and your choice of cheese sauce or hollandaise. I chose bacon and hollandaise (duh!). I didn't wait more than 5 minutes and the food was delivered, piping hot. It was tasty and my waitress was quite lovely and attentive. I only subtracted one star because the bacon and hash browns could have cooked a bit longer (bacon was chewy in a couple of bites and no color at all to the hash browns). I highly recommend this restaurant, the people are fantastic, and it's an obvious beloved place due to how many patrons there were. I also got a caramel roll to go (it was the last one available) since they were going to be closed for Christmas, and I didn't want the bakery items going to waste. The waitress scraped every bit of extra caramel out of the pan for my to go roll, so I gave her an extra tip on the tip. Go support Merlins when you are in the area, and even if you are not in the area, it is well worth the drive.

    Legit delicious!! I file this under hole-in-the-wall or dive-bar - and those terms aren't…read morederogatory in the least! This is on the edge of "the middle of nowhere" (unless of course you're one of the fine folks that lives nearby). But disregard all of that - the service and the FOOD were both top notch! Different daily specials every day (see the picture) and the regular menu is HUGE! Hubby had a Peanut Butter and Jalapeño Jam burger - big 1/2 pounder - with fresh fries. I thought the fries were a little soggy (literally the only negative) but they were deliciously seasoned. I had a shaved beef with Au Jus. Now I know that sounds dull but it wasn't! The roll was super-soft but lightly toasted with a buttery taste and the beef (I'm told by the VERY fabulous waitress) is sliced from their weekly prime-rib special. I had it with a slide of slaw and GOOD LORD they actually know how to make excellent slaw! Again - same fabulous waitress says that the dressing is house-made. It really, REALLY was good. Add three tap beers and our lunch was a sweet $33. I wish we had an easier more frequent reason to stop because the menu has me intrigued! I definitely recommend it!
